Given that your roof is always exposed to the outside elements, it means your roof is will degrade with time. The rate at which it degrades will depend upon a variety of variables. Those include; the grade of the initial materials used as well as the workmanship, the level of abuse it has to take from the elements, how well the roof is maintained and the style of the roof. Most roofing professionals will quote around 20 years for a well-built and properly maintained roof, but that can never be promised because of the above variables. Our advice is to consistently keep your roof well maintained and get regular checkups to be sure it lasts as long as possible.
You shouldn’t ever pressure-wash your roof, as you run the risk of removing any covering materials that have been added to provide protection from the elements. In addition, you should stay away from chlorine-based bleach cleaning products since they can also reduce the life of your roof. When you speak to your roof cleaning expert, ask them to use an EPA-approved algaecide/fungicide to wash your roof. That will get rid of the ugly algae and discoloration without destroying the tile or shingles.

New Palestine (pronounced PAL-es-tēn) is a town in Sugar Creek Township, Hancock County, Indiana, along Sugar Creek. The population was 2,055 at the 2010 census.
New Palestine was laid out October 1, 1838, by Jonathan Evans.[6] It first consisted of fifteen blocks and thirty six lots.[7] A petition for the incorporation of New Palestine as a town was dated May 22, 1871, and presented to the board of county commissioners at the June session of 1871. At the time of the petition, New Palestine had a population of 279 people. The vote for incorporation was held on June 24, 1871. Many years after incorporation, the town had difficulty with its name. The post office was known as Sugar Creek, the railroad and express stations as Palestine and the name of the town itself was New Palestine. Through the efforts of E.F. Faut and Congressman Bynum, the name of the post office was changed from Sugar Creek to New Palestine on January 16, 1889, and the name of the railroad station and express office were also changed to New Palestine.

A lot of today’s low slope metal roofing systems are made from corrugated galvanized steel a steel sheet coated with zinc. Copper, aluminum, stainless steel and tin also are used in business metal roofing applications.
Furthermore, metal roofing systems can withstand high winds and are mainly impact resistant. Nevertheless, the investment for a metal roof option likely will be much higher upfront than other flat roof options. Low slope structural metal roof is commonly called standing seam roof and includes interlocking panels that run vertically along the roofing surface area.

Some metal roof utilized on low slope applications requires maker seaming during setup to make sure a leak-proof seal. A seaming device is simply rolled along the panels to crimp the panel joints together. A standing joint design guarantees appropriate draining pipes from rain and snow, effectively getting rid of ponding, leaks and related problems.

This might lead to a longer life period and low annual operating expenses. In retrofit tasks, a sub-framing system is connected to the existing flat roofing surface to offer a minimum:12 roofing pitch. Alternatives for the remediation of a metal roof surface area include acrylic coatings made of polymers that cure to form a durable, constant elastomeric membrane over the surface of the metal roofing and can be contributed to metal roof to address your structure’s specific needs around waterproofing, rust and UV defense.
Acrylic coverings are water-based, non-flammable and produce no poisonous fumes. These systems can hold up against the most common kinds of roofing system risks, consisting of ultraviolet light, temperature level extremes, mildew, normal foot traffic and structure movement.
